Reproductive Success
The relative production of fertile offspring by a genotype. In practical terms, the number of offspring produced by individual members of a population is tallied and compared to that of others.
Plant-Human Interactions
The various ways in which plants and humans affect each other's lives, ranging from agriculture to cultural practices.
Domestication
The process by which humans modify the genetic features of plants and animals to accentuate traits that are beneficial for humankind.
Disturbed Habitats
Natural environments that have been altered or degraded by human activities or natural events, affecting the native species and ecosystem balance.
